IT WOULD take a fool to say that the past 13 years of Labour rule have passed without disappointments and problems.
But equally it would be wrong to forget the Government's many achievements - the minimum wage, increased spending on health and education, a stable currency (unlike under the last Conservative administration) and falling levels of crime.See the full content of this document
